We have an career opportunity for a Business Data Analyst with our client in Columbus. We're looking for a Lead BSA Analyst to partner with business and technical teams to define, refine, and deliver data-centric solutions that power enterprise insights.
This role is critical to our Enterprise Data Warehouse (EDW) efforts and involves deep collaboration with stakeholders to gather and document business needs, translate them into technical requirements, and support Agile delivery using tools like Snowflake, DataStage, Python/PySpark, Infogix, and Tableau.
🔍 What You’ll Do
- Lead requirement gathering sessions with business stakeholders to uncover true data and reporting needs.
- Document detailed technical and functional requirements, with a strong emphasis on data sourcing, transformation, and validation.
- Work with Product Owners to translate Epics into actionable Features and detailed User Stories.
- Create and maintain data mapping documentation (source-to-target) and support data validation efforts.
- Facilitate backlog refinement sessions to clarify story details, ensure acceptance criteria are met, and support story point estimation.
- Act as a liaison between business, product, and development teams to ensure clarity and alignment.
- Identify and escalate data or requirement-related blockers to the Scrum Master.
